In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ding TA6 3NU is primarily male, with 58.9%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 49.4% | 41.1% | -8.3% | 51.0% | -9.9% |
| Male | 50.6% | 58.9% | 8.3% | 49.0% | 9.9%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Old Taunton Road was 311.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 16.8% higher than the Bridgwater South average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Old Taunton Road has the 5th highest crime rate of 92 local areas in Bridgwater South and the 83rd highest crime rate of 1,848 local areas in Somerset .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 167.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-17.9%.

Households in this area have a lower level of wealth compared to the average household in England and Wales. 77% of analyzed areas in England and Wales have higher average household annual income than this area.
